Description:
Eight piece molded whiteware covered slop pot, covered commode (or change pot), basin, large and small pitcher, jar, cup, and three piece soap dish with handles, appendages in low relief and decorated with printed floral decals in brown and hand-painted violet, blue, pink, yellow with feathered golden edges and painted stylized leaves and geometric motifs near the appendages.
